
Adams (MSC Software)
Adams, developed by MSC Software, is a powerful computer-aided engineering tool used to simulate and analyze the motion of mechanical systems. It helps engineers predict how complex assemblies—like vehicles, robotics, or machinery—will move, interact, and respond under various conditions. By modeling components and their connections digitally, Adams allows for virtual testing, identifying design issues early, reducing physical prototypes, and optimizing performance. It’s widely used across industries to improve safety, efficiency, and durability of mechanical designs, making it a vital tool for engineers working on dynamic systems.
